โฆ Synopsis
Technology Features:
- super series featuring tried and tested technology activities
- each unit of work allows pupils to plan, construct and evaluate
- activities can be completed individually, in pairs or small groups
- uses inexpensive, readily available materials
- Middle level contains 6 seven-page units: mouse exercise yard bug catcher bookends wind chime treasure and vehicle.
